  • Publication number: 20070233725
    Abstract: A control system in a vehicle for extracting meta data from a digital media storage device over a communication link. The system includes a communication module for establishing a communication link with the digital media storage device. The system also includes a processing module coupled to the communication module. The processing module is configured to retrieve, via the communication module, meta data associated with a media file from the digital media storage device. The meta data includes a plurality of entries, wherein at least one of the plurality of entries includes text data. The processing module is also configured to compare the text data of the entries with a set of data files stored in a database. The system also includes a memory module configured to store the plurality of entries retrieved from the digital media storage device.

  • Publication number: 20070082706
    Abstract: A system for selecting a user speech profile for a device in a vehicle includes a control module having a speech recognition system and a memory. The speech recognition system is configured to process audio signals and includes a speaker enrollment function configured to create a user speech profile for at least one user. The memory is configured to store a plurality of user speech profiles created by the speaker enrollment function. The system may include an external device configured to transmit a control signal to the vehicle including an identifier. Alternatively, the system may include a user input device configured to receive an input command from a user that includes an identifier. The control module uses the identifier to select a user speech profile from the plurality of user speech profiles and the speech recognition system uses the selected user speech profile to process audio signals from the user.

  • Publication number: 20070061067
    Abstract: A method for accessing data files with an in-vehicle control system from a remote source over a communication link. The communication link is established between an in-vehicle control system and the remote source. The method includes: establishing the communication link between the in-vehicle control system and the remote source to facilitate retrieving the data files from the remote source to the in-vehicle control system; retrieving at least one of the data files from the remote source over the communication link, wherein each of the data files may include text and numeric data; identifying the text and numeric data of each of the data files; generating a phonemic representation of the text and numeric data of the data files; and storing the data file retrieved from a remote source in a memory device.

  • Publication number: 20060168627
    Abstract: A control module for a wireless communication system in a vehicle having a plurality of operational settings includes a memory, a control circuit and a radio frequency transceiver. The memory is configured to store a plurality of performance characteristics associated with at least one mobile wireless communication device. The control circuit is coupled to the memory and is configured to retrieve at least one performance characteristic for a mobile wireless communication device associated with a vehicle occupant and used in conjunction with the wireless communication system. The control circuit is further configured to adjust at least one operational setting of the wireless communication system based on the at least one performance characteristics of the mobile wireless communication device. The radio frequency transceiver is coupled to the control circuit and is configured to communicate with the mobile wireless communication device.
